Teachers familiar with the Geog Dot series will be familiar with Walter's Global Jeans.
It's been around for a while now, and is a good way of visualising the global trade in clothing, and the pursuit of the lowest cost location by trans-national companies.
This BBC article brought to my attention by Global Dimension looks at another intriguing environmental dimension to jeans production: the act of sandblasting them to give them a 'distressed' look....
Could be a useful addition to the set of resources for globalisation work.
